What are the components of an M&E plan?

An M&E plan helps to define, implement, track and improve a monitoring and evaluation strategy within a particular project or a group of projects; it includes all the steps, elements and activities that need to happen from the project planning phase until the project reaches its goal and creates the intended impact.

What are monitoring and evaluation practices?

Practices in M&E refer to the patterns that have been identified to be efficacious in improving project performance. Such practices have been accepted by practitioners as an effective way to implement M&E in projects (Webb and Elliot, 2000).

What is the purpose of this M&E plan?

The purpose of an M&E plan is to encourage project or programme staff to think clearly about what they intend doing in the way of M&E before implementation of a project or programme begins, and to ensure those plans are adequately documented.

What is M&E work plan?

Overview of Monitoring and Evaluation Work Plans As a guide, the M&E Work Plan explains the goals and objectives of the overall plan as well as the evaluation questions, methodologies, implementation plan, matrix of expected results, proposed timeline, and M&E instruments for gathering data.

    What is monitoring and evaluation all about?

    Monitoring and evaluation. Monitoring and Evaluation (M&E) is a process that helps improve performance and achieve results. Its goal is to improve current and future management of outputs, outcomes and impact.

    How monitoring and evaluation is done?

    Steps Identify Program Goals and Objectives. The first step to creating an M&E plan is to identify the program goals and objectives. Define Indicators. Once the program’s goals and objectives are defined, it is time to define indicators for tracking progress towards achieving those goals. Define Data Collection Methods and TImeline.
